Core concepts

Concept 1

Expansion distributes every term and requires careful signs when brackets or squared binomials are involved.

Exam cue: Mark each multiplication when expanding more than two terms.

Concept 2

Factorisation can use a common factor, difference of squares, unitary or non-unitary trinomial structure, or combinations.

Exam cue: Check for a common factor before using another pattern.

Concept 3

A fully factorised result has every common factor extracted and every required polynomial factor completed.

Exam cue: Multiply factors back mentally to verify coefficients and signs.

Memory anchors

Distribution

Every term outside a bracket multiplies every term inside it.

Common factor

Extract the greatest expression shared by all terms first.

Difference of squares

a² − b² = (a − b)(a + b).

Unitary trinomial

Find two numbers whose product is c and sum is b.

Non-unitary trinomial

Use factors whose cross-products combine to the middle coefficient.

Factor check

Expand the answer to recover the original expression.
